Ref.:
*Sel anak* yang berukuran kecil yang berinti lebih besar dan sitoplasma lebih pekat membelah sekali lagi dengan bidang pembelahan sejajar dengan arah pembelahan sebelumnya.
The smaller *daughter cell* which has a larger nucleus and dense cytoplasm will divide once more in a plane parallel to the preceding plane of division.
http://digilib.bi.itb.ac.id/go.php?id=jbptitbbi-gdl-s2-1983-...
Cell division is a process by which a cell, called the parent cell, divides into two or more cells, called *daughter cells*.
http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Cell_division
The GSC undergoes asymmetric cell division, giving rise to one *daughter cell* that will retain *stem cell* identity and one *daughter cell* . . .
http://jcs.biologists.org/cgi/content/figsonly/118/4/665
Kamus Saku Kedokteran Dorland. 1998. Jakarta: EGC.
